But in essence, the difference between our packages, and what sorts of logo design briefs they suit is quite simple.

What all our logo design orders include

  • Custom designs completed by a professional small business logo designer
  • Unlimited revisions
  • A full set of final files

You should order the 2 logo concepts package if

  • You have a very specific brief, and a clear idea of what you want

If you aren’t sure what you want this is not the package for you. If you aren’t sure what you want we advise you order more concepts as this will give the designers a chance to try out a number of ideas which you may like. If your budget is limited and this is all you can afford then try to brainstorm, get inspired, think about your brand and see what you can come up with and give us a call to talk it over.

You should order the 6 logo concepts package if

  • You have an idea, but you’d like to see some other options too

If you don’t have any ideas then the 6 logo concepts package is an option, but we would advise that the 10 concept package is the better choice. With the 6 logo concepts package you have 3 designers reading your brief and interpreting it, whereas with the 10 concept package you have 5 – giving a wider variety of ideas.

You should order the 10 logo concepts package if

  • You don’t know what sort of logo you want and you’d like to see quite a few different options
  • You have an idea, but you’d  also like to give the designers some scope to show you some creative ideas of their own

Add-ons and extras you might need

If you’d like a complex drawing or illustration as part of your logo then you’ll have to upgrade to an illustration logo design (an additional £60 + VAT on top of your order). To read more about illustration logos and to see some examples click here.

Another extra you may require is the creation of an additional set of final files (for instance you might want a version of your logo without the icon, or tagline). To get an additional set of final files costs £30 + VAT (this cost is to cover the administration time to create all the files, which takes about an hour).
